2. Geto Suguru Struggles to Track Toji Fushiguro’s Location

From the upper floor, Toji casually walked while conversing with Geto, who stood below. Geto struggled to detect Toji’s presence since Toji had no cursed energy, forcing him to rely solely on the sound of Toji’s voice to pinpoint his location.

Geto unleashed a Cursed Technique toward the ceiling where he believed Toji was positioned. However, thanks to his incredible speed, Toji instantly appeared on the same floor as Geto, standing behind him, even though there was still a considerable distance between them.

Toji then explained to Geto that his presence couldn’t be tracked because he had no cursed energy. The only time he could be detected was when he wielded a Cursed Tool. Even the cursed spirits he kept within his body were undetectable.

Toji proceeded to spit out a cursed spirit from his mouth, which then retrieved a weapon from inside its body. Toji intended to use this weapon to fight Geto. Geto, however, told Toji to end the conversation, knowing that Toji possessed the Heavenly Restriction—a talent that made him stronger when he revealed his abilities to his opponents.
